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

NetherlandsNormally I don't like shared bathrooms. Here it was no issue.
Excellent location, foot steps from Meuse. Huge rooms. Shared bathrooms where huge and did not cause any problem. Lovely garden. Very nice mansion to stay and a fabulous host. We had the luck that a spontaneous piano concert was given. Nice place to meet interesting people. Mouzay itself has a bakery, but breakfast is included. You come to enjoy the peace and space. Stenay is 2km away and Dun-sur-Meuse is also close by for restuarants and shops.
